Rode NT4 Stereo Condenser Microphone
Stereo Condenser Microphone
The Rode NT4 Microphone offers an excellent way to produce high-quality stereo recordings in any scenario. Its 90-degree X/Y configuration consists of two ½-inch condenser microphones that are acoustically matched, providing an accurate stereo audio image suitable for various applications such as drum overheads, foley, and sound design.

The Rode NT4 is a stereo recording microphone featuring dual cardioid capsules mounted in a X/Y stereo configuration. The microphone is designed for field or studio use and provides transparent sound reproduction and accurate representation of signal within the "Left/Right" stereo field. This provides optimum results when capturing live performances, ambiance, instruments, choruses, choirs etc.
The NT4's pressure gradient capsules feature cardioid polar patterns which effectively minimize off-axis audience, instrument and ambient noise resulting in accurate recordings of the desired source material. The microphone's dual elements are matched in frequency response and sensitivity for accurate sound reproduction on both left and right stereo channels.
The NT4 features an On/Off switch for added control and is powered via Phantom Power or standard 9 volt alkaline battery. The microphone includes a dual XLR microphone cable, stereo mini microphone cable and durable road case. 9 volt alkaline battery functionality and included stereo mini cable, make the NT4 suitable for videographers as well as live sound and recording engineers.
